What to expect

Walk-in private GP appointments in London usually involve a short wait at reception followed by a 10–15 minute consultation. Bring photo ID and proof of address; some clinics may also ask for your NHS number, though it is not always required. The GP can prescribe medications, issue sick notes, and refer you onward to specialists if needed. Costs are usually the same as booked appointments at the same clinic. If the practice is busy and you cannot wait, most will offer a same-day booking for later that day.

  • Do walk-in private GPs cost more than booked appointments?
    Walk-in fees are typically the same as booked appointments at the same clinic. A small number of clinics apply a walk-in premium. Specific fees are listed on each clinic page.
  • What ID do I need for a walk-in private GP?
    Most clinics ask for photo ID and proof of address at first visit, although requirements vary. Insurance details may be needed if claiming through a health insurer. Your NHS number is helpful but not usually required.
  • How long is the wait at a walk-in private GP?
    Wait times at London walk-in private GPs range from 15 minutes to over an hour, depending on the time of day and clinic. Mid-morning and lunch tend to be busier; early opening and late afternoon often have shorter waits.
